Bonfire, 'Super Cane,' highlight Homecoming The spirit of Liberty High's Homecoming game was overwhelming this year, mainly because of very active participation by the students. The festivities were kicked off the night before by a dance featuring the music of Equinox. During the dance, Cathy Wescoe was crowned Homecoming Queen. The most unforgettable event was the car smash, spon- sored by the Senior Class, which ended up as a bonfire when a customer accidentally dropped a match into the theoretically empty gas tank. Hundreds of students gathered to cheer the firefighters as they proceeded to extinguish the flames. This set the pace for the rest of the day. Daybreak, a nationally known musical group, pro- vided entertainment in the girls' gym before the pep rally. Students and teachers alike joined in the dancing and applauded heartily the performance by the group. Highlighting the pep rally itself were the rivalry antics of the Mad Hatters and their opponents, the Mad Hat-Hers. Meanwhile Mr. Klein, alias Super Cane, exhibited sev- eral George Blanda-like touchdown stunts wearing a 010 football jersey. Liberty Life, the sponsor of an all- school raffle, announbed the winner at the -pep rally. Dave McNeely, who had purchased the winning ticket, was presented with a portable television. When game time finally arrived, the bleachers were filled to capacity. Liberty students waved red and blue shakers distributed by the Senior Class while a blimp over- head provided an added attraction to the game. It was fitting that after a whole day of festivities and cheering, the Liberty Hurricanes overpowered the Pates in a 41-0 victory.
